How to care for lotus during its flowering period

1. Flowering period

The blooming of lotus is unique in that it opens one by one without interfering with each other. The flowering period of a single flower is relatively short, only a few days, but compared with the flowering period of a group of lotus flowers, the flowering period is very long. The flowering period varies between the north and the south due to climate differences, with more than three months in the south and only about two months in the north. Generally, after the lotus stamens emerge from the water, you can see them blooming about ten days later.

2. Maintenance during flowering period

(1) Soil selection

The growing environment of lotus is different from that of other flowers. You can go to ponds or streams to get silt. If you are worried that the water will become turbid after adding silt, you can first use fine sand from the river to lay the bottom, and then add silt. This will ensure that the water is clear and allow the lotus to grow stably.

(2) Water quality issues

If you plant lotus in a small pond, you don't need to change the water frequently, just replenish the water in time; the lotus in the culture dish can be changed every one or two weeks to ensure the water quality is clean. In summer, you must replenish water in time and never let it lack water, and in winter you need to take appropriate warming measures.

(3) Fertilization issues

Lotus is generally fertilized with phosphorus fertilizer, and a little nitrogen fertilizer can be added if necessary. If you are not sure, you can directly buy special fertilizer. If you have organic fertilizer at home, it is recommended to mix it with the silt before adding it, the effect will be better. In the summer when lotus is growing vigorously, if you find that the lotus leaves are turning yellow or falling off, you can add some urea into the mud, but not too much.

(4) Disease problems

The prevention and control of diseases should mainly focus on preventive measures, such as selecting excellent disease-resistant varieties and promptly cleaning up dead branches and diseased leaves. In addition, the combination of water and drought can effectively avoid harmful bacteria.
